The Gospel of Matthew Chapter 17 Verses 14 thru 20

14 When they came to the crowd a man approached, knelt down before him, 15 and said, “Lord, have pity on my son, for he is a lunatic and suffers severely; often he falls into fire, and often into water. 16 I brought him to your disciples, but they could not cure him.” 17 Jesus said in reply, “O faithless and perverse generation, how long will I be with you? How long will I endure you? Bring him here to me.”18 Jesus rebuked him and the demon came out of him, and from that hour the boy was cured. 19 Then the disciples approached Jesus in private and said, “Why could we not drive it out?” 20 He said to them, “Because of your little faith. Amen, I say to you, if you have faith the size of a mustard seed, you will say to this mountain, ‘Move from here to there,’ and it will move. Nothing will be impossible for you.”

In Matthew 17:14-20, we encounter a profound moment in the ministry of Jesus that speaks volumes about faith and its power. A desperate father brings his afflicted son to Jesus, seeking healing that the disciples could not provide. The boy is tormented by seizures, embodying the struggles and challenges we encounter in life. Jesus, in a moment of compassion and authority, addresses the situation, demonstrating that it is not merely human effort that effects change but faith in Him as the ultimate miracle worker.

In verse 20, Jesus tells His disciples that even faith as small as a mustard seed can move mountains. This statement is a powerful reminder that our faith does not need to be enormous; what matters is the object of our faith—Jesus Christ. It is easy to become disheartened by our circumstances, feeling that our limited faith is inadequate. However, we must remember that it is not our faith alone that performs miracles; it is our faith in the grace of Jesus. When we call upon His name, we tap into divine power that transcends our human limitations.

As believers, we are called to acknowledge that it is in Jesus alone that we find our strength. He is the miracle worker who embodies grace, and it is through His name that we see transformation. The challenges we face can seem insurmountable, but with faith in Christ, we are assured that even the smallest flicker of belief holds the power to overcome. Let us continually call out to Jesus, trusting in His grace to work miracles within our souls and situations. Remember, true victory lies not in our own striving, but in the unfathomable grace of Jesus Christ. Amen.
